Where was the Oregon Trail?
The trail started in Independence, Missouri, and finished in Oregon City.
How did people travel on the Oregon Trail?

Why did people travel the Oregon Trail?
People wanted to move west, as they had heard of rich farming lands which they could obtain for free. The economic conditions in the east were not good, so people saw it as a new opportunity.
Who established the Oregon Trail?
Jedediah Smith established the Oregon Trail in 1825, when he discovered the South Pass through the Rocky Mountains.
What problems were there using the Oregon Trail?
Getting stuck.
Drowning while crossing rivers.
Accidents with wagons.
Illness and disease, such as cholera.
Running out of supplies.
Fear of attack from Native Americans, although there are no recorded accounts of any.
The length of the journey. The average journey on the Oregon Trail took four months.
